About Redbank 4301

The size of Redbank is approximately 8.3 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 3.1% of total area. The population of Redbank in 2011 was 1,605 people. By 2016 the population was 1,848 showing a population growth of 15.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Redbank is 10-19 years. Households in Redbank are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Redbank work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 52% of the homes in Redbank were owner-occupied compared with 49.6% in 2016.

Redbank has 1,354 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Redbank have seen a 105.36%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 77.80%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Redbank is $701,422 while the median value for Units is $471,574.
  • Houses have a median rent of $520 while Units have a median rent of $418.
